Highlights
Are people in Brighton older or younger than people in West Haven?
- The Median Age in Brighton is 5.7 years older than in West Haven.

Are housing costs cheaper in Brighton or West Haven?
- Brighton housing costs are 9.9% less expensive than West Haven hous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Brighton or West Haven?
- The average commute for residents of Brighton is 7.9 minutes longer than it is for residents of West Haven.
